Senior Associate, Backend Engineer

2 weeks ago


Singapore DBS Bank Limited Full time
The Team

The DBS Investments and Trading Technologies (ITT) Machine Learning Team works with stakeholders across all pillars of the Global Financial Markets (GFM) Department to create proprietary data science solutions for trading, sales, and operations.

We are seeking a dynamic Backend Engineer (Data, AI/ ML) who excels in fast-paced environments and possesses a solid background in software and data engineering. As a key member of our team, you will be responsible for building large-scale software systems in areas such as dynamic pricing, trading analytics, personalized marketing, and Generative AI.

Responsibilities
  1. Design and implement large-scale machine learning software systems.
  2. Enhance system design and architecture for stability, performance, and reliability of machine learning applications.
  3. Develop scalable data processing pipelines/ workflows and optimize database connections.
  4. Design and integrate RESTful APIs for seamless communication with external services.
  5. Maintain Python-based ML applications, libraries, and APIs using Python 3.
  6. Create pipelines for continuous operation, feedback, and monitoring of ML models following MLOps best practices.

Minimum Requirements:
  1. Bachelor's degree in computer science, software engineering, or equivalent.
  2. 3-5 years of Python development experience, with expertise in Python 3.
  3. Strong understanding of API development, database connectivity, and programming basics.
  4. Deep knowledge of software design, computer architectures, and algorithms.
  5. Familiarity with multiprocessing techniques for efficient event-based processing.
  6. Experience designing and implementing large-scale distributed data systems.
  7. Understanding of CI/CD pipelines, agile methodologies, and software deployment.

Good to Have (Two or more):
  1. Background in statistics, data science, or machine learning.
  2. Familiarity with key infra technologies like NoSQL solutions (MongoDB, ElasticSearch), Openshift, Kubernetes.
  3. Experience with machine learning frameworks and MLOps tools.
  4. Experience building scalable ML system architectures and big-data pipelines.
  5. Proficiency in Kafka/ActiveMQ and Redis for message queueing and event-driven architectures.
  6. Experience in high-concurrency application development, high-performance design, coding and performance tuning.
  7. Knowledge of language models, RAG concepts, and generative AI frameworks.


  • Singapore Mighty Bear Games Pte. Ltd. Full time

    We are on the prowl for more Bears to join us at our Global HQ (AKA Bear Force One)! Being a Bear means that you'll be part of a culture that celebrates diversity and is dedicated to making games which make players smile.We are looking for a highly experienced and talented Senior Backend Engineer who is passionate about delivering the highest quality of...


  • Singapore Shopee Full time

    Job Description:As a Senior Backend Engineer, you will play a crucial role in the development of real-time chat systems and contribute to the success of our product. You will be responsible for analyzing product requirements, designing technical solutions, and building large-scale distributed systems optimized for performance, availability, and scalability....


  • Singapore NTUC LearningHub Full time

    COMPANY DESCRIPTIONNTUC LearningHub (NTUC LHUB) was established in 2004 to transform the Singapore workforce so that it can keep pace with the burgeoning demands of a dynamic economy. Our courses and training programmes have since grown to cover a wide range of disciplines that include Infocomm Technology, Workplace Safety and Health, Security, Human...


  • Singapore NTUC LearningHub Full time

    COMPANY DESCRIPTIONNTUC LearningHub (NTUC LHUB) was established in 2004 to transform the Singapore workforce so that it can keep pace with the burgeoning demands of a dynamic economy. Our courses and training programmes have since grown to cover a wide range of disciplines that include Infocomm Technology, Workplace Safety and Health, Security, Human...

  • Backend Engineer

    1 week ago


    Singapore Technology Services Group Pte. Ltd. Full time

    As a Backend Engineer specializing, you will be responsible for designing, developing, and maintaining backend systems that support the integration and optimization of AI models & LLM in trading applications. You will work closely with the AI engineering team to integrate various machine learning models and algorithms into the backend systems to address...

  • Backend Engineer

    1 week ago


    Singapore TECHNOLOGY SERVICES GROUP PTE. LTD. Full time

    Roles & ResponsibilitiesAs a Backend Engineer specializing, you will be responsible for designing, developing, and maintaining backend systems that support the integration and optimization of AI models & LLM in trading applications. You will work closely with the AI engineering team to integrate various machine learning models and algorithms into the backend...


  • Singapore GARENA ONLINE PRIVATE LIMITED Full time

    Roles & ResponsibilitiesJob Description Server-side design and development of the services/ systems/platforms used by our products and our users. Write high-quality, clean, simple, and maintainable code; build common libraries. Analyse requirements, design, and develop functionalities based on product requirements. Understand the product thoroughly,...


  • Singapore Technology Services Group Pte. Ltd. Full time

    About Us:Vama is an innovative chat and payment platform committed to revolutionizing communication and transactions. Our team is passionate about creating seamless, secure, and user-friendly experiences for our customers.Role Overview:We are seeking a skilled Backend Engineer to join our talented team. As a backend engineer at Vama, you will be vital in...


  • Singapore I.o.t. Workz Pte. Ltd. Full time

    Location: OnsiteWe are seeking a skilled Backend Support Engineer to join our team, providing critical onsite support, system maintenance, testing, and troubleshooting for our backend systems. As a Backend Support Engineer, you will play a key role in ensuring the stability, performance, and reliability of our backend infrastructure. The ideal candidate...

  • Backend Engineer

    1 week ago


    Singapore Hydrax Pte. Ltd. Full time

    About the Company: We are is a digital asset custodian operating in Malaysia, committed to providing secure and reliable custody solutions for digital assets. Our mission is to ensure the safety and integrity of our clients' digital assets through robust security measures and cutting-edge technology.Job Summary: We are recruiting an experienced Backend...


  • Singapore I.O.T. WORKZ PTE. LTD. Full time

    Roles & ResponsibilitiesLocation: OnsiteWe are seeking a skilled Backend Support Engineer to join our team, providing critical onsite support, system maintenance, testing, and troubleshooting for our backend systems. As a Backend Support Engineer, you will play a key role in ensuring the stability, performance, and reliability of our backend infrastructure....


  • Singapore TECHNOLOGY SERVICES GROUP PTE. LTD. Full time

    Roles & ResponsibilitiesAbout Us:Vama is an innovative chat and payment platform committed to revolutionizing communication and transactions. Our team is passionate about creating seamless, secure, and user-friendly experiences for our customers.Role Overview:We are seeking a skilled Backend Engineer to join our talented team. As a backend engineer at Vama,...


  • Singapore ScienTec Consulting Full time

    We are looking for a Senior Backend Developer proficient in Java Spring to work on large scale nation-wide projects. 5 days work week (Mon - Fri). Attractive remuneration package. Hybrid work arrangement. Responsibilities: Actively participate in backend software development (Java Spring). Work closely with stakeholders throughout the software development...


  • Singapore ScienTec Consulting Full time

    We are looking for a Senior Backend Developer proficient in Java Spring to work on large scale projects. 5 days work week (Mon - Fri). Attractive remuneration package. Hybrid work arrangement. Responsibilities: Actively participate in backend software development (Java Spring). Work closely with stakeholders throughout the software development life cycle....

  • Process Engineer

    1 month ago


    Singapore Silicon Box Pte. Ltd. Full time

    Process Engineer / Senior Process Engineer (Back End) is responsible for development and establishment of production process.ResponsibilitiesReview and accept machine buyoff, setup pilot line process and transfer from pilot line to production line.Establish, review and update specifications, workflow, quality and safety related documentation for production...


  • Singapore Garena Online Private Limited Full time

    Job DescriptionWork with and materialize practical product ideas atop the latest technologies, bridging the gap between the forefront of technological advancement and people's needs.Server-side design, development and deployment of the services/systems/platforms used by our products and our users.Research the latest technologies and development trends in...


  • Singapore Quinnox Solutions Pte. Ltd. Full time

    Junior Backend Engineer - Job DescriptionAs Junior Backend Engineer in the Mobile and App team, we expect you to have a strong interest in technology and ability to drive innovation with creative solutions. You should have a broad expertise and experience in various areas such as web, mobile, Cloud, emerging technologies and services.Key...

  • Backend Engineer

    4 hours ago


    Singapore H2 GAMES PTE. LTD. Full time

    Roles & ResponsibilitiesWe are looking for a Backend Engineer to join our team. You will be responsible in the development and maintenance of back-end systems . Your expertise in web technologies will help us deliver quality products that captivate our audience.Job Responsibilities: Lead the technical architecture and feature design of business systems and...


  • Singapore SENSERBOT PTE. LTD. Full time

    Roles & ResponsibilitiesAbout Senserbot:Since 2016, Senserbot has been a leader in automation solutions and robotics, specialising in advanced technology for asset tracking, inventory control, and stock-taking. We are committed to advancing state-of-the-art solutions for businesses and organisations.Role Overview:We are excited to welcome a talented...


  • Singapore QUINNOX SOLUTIONS PTE. LTD. Full time

    Roles & ResponsibilitiesJunior Backend Engineer - Job DescriptionAs Junior Backend Engineer in the Mobile and App team, we expect you to have a strong interest in technology and ability to drive innovation with creative solutions. You should have a broad expertise and experience in various areas such as web, mobile, Cloud, emerging technologies and...